Basically we have grime music although not as popular as it was in the early to late 00s,afro swing which is a subgenre of afro beats music created by british nigerians and ghanaians.Quick witt and a sarcastic sense of humour. We call it british sense of humour. We also tend to dress smartly with the occasional hint of street. Ralph lauren polos,buttoned up shirts,jeans rather than tracksuits.
We are also big on trainers (sneakers).
Mainly huarraches,air max 90s and air max 97s.
Also we have our own slang which is a mix of jamaican patois and the occasional bit of cockney.
Cockney is basically words,slang and an accent used mainly by east london white people

Most of these elements stems from the Griots in the Westside.

There's many forms of rapping. In Jamaica, its toasting (rhyming to a riddim). In Congo, they call it "animation" or "atalaku" (Atalaku in Kikongo me check me out. Some atalakus rap in a singing voice and some do the traditional, same as in Hip Hop.
